    Aspects of early arthritis. What determines the evolution of early undifferentiated arthritis and rheumatoid arthritis? An update from the Norfolk Arthritis Register

    Over 3500 patients with recent onset inflammatory polyarthritis (IP) have been recruited by the Norfolk Arthritis Register (NOAR) since 1990. Longitudinal data from this cohort have been used to examine the prevalence and predictors of remission, functional disability, radiological outcome, cardiovascular mortality and co-morbidity and the development of non-Hodgkin's lymphoma. Rheumatoid factor titre, high baseline C-reactive protein and high baseline HAQ score are all predictors of a poor outcome. There is a strong association between possession of the shared epitope and the development of erosions. Patients who satisfy the American College of Rheumatology criteria for rheumatoid arthritis (RA) have a worse prognosis than those who do not. However, it appears that these patients are a poorly defined subset of all those with IP rather than having an entirely separate disease entity. New statistical techniques offer exciting possibilities for using longitudinal datasets such as NOAR to explore the long-term effects of treatment in IP and RA

    Exploring the validity of estimating EQ-5D and SF-6D utility values from the health assessment questionnaire in patients with inflammatory arthritis

    <p>Abstract</p> <p>Background</p> <p>Utility scores are used to estimate Quality Adjusted Life Years (QALYs), applied in determining the cost-effectiveness of health care interventions. In studies where no preference based measures are collected, indirect methods have been developed to estimate utilities from clinical instruments. The aim of this study was to evaluate a published method of estimating the EuroQol-5D (EQ-5D) and Short Form-6D (SF-6D) (preference based) utility scores from the Health Assessment Questionnaire (HAQ) in patients with inflammatory arthritis.</p> <p>Methods</p> <p>Data were used from 3 cohorts of patients with: early inflammatory arthritis (<10 weeks duration); established (>5 years duration) stable rheumatoid arthritis (RA); and RA being treated with anti-TNF therapy. Patients completed the EQ-5D, SF-6D and HAQ at baseline and a follow-up assessment. EQ-5D and SF-6D scores were predicted from the HAQ using a published method. Differences between predicted and observed EQ-5D and SF-6D scores were assessed using the paired t-test and linear regression.</p> <p>Results</p> <p>Predicted utility scores were generally higher than observed scores (range of differences: EQ-5D 0.01 - 0.06; SF-6D 0.05 - 0.10). Change between predicted values of the EQ-5D and SF-6D corresponded well with observed change in patients with established RA. Change in predicted SF-6D scores was, however, less than half of that in observed values (p < 0.001) in patients with more active disease. Predicted EQ-5D scores underestimated change in cohorts of patients with more active disease.</p> <p>Conclusion</p> <p>Predicted utility scores overestimated baseline values but underestimated change. Predicting utility values from the HAQ will therefore likely underestimate the QALYs of interventions, particularly for patients with active disease. We recommend the inclusion of at least one preference based measure in future clinical studies.</p

    Persistence with anti-tumour necrosis factor therapies in patients with psoriatic arthritis: observational study from the British Society of Rheumatology Biologics Register

    Objectives. To evaluate the risk–benefit profile of anti-TNF therapies in PsA and to study the predictors of treatment response and disease remission [disease activity score (DAS)-28 < 2.6]. Methods. The study included PsA patients (n = 596) registered with the British Society for Rheumatology Biologics Register (BSRBR). Response was assessed using the European League against Rheumatism (EULAR) improvement criteria. Univariate and multivariate logistic regression models were developed to examine factors associated with EULAR response and disease remission using a range of covariates. Poisson regression was used to calculate incidence rate ratios (IRRs) for serious adverse events (SAEs) vs seronegative RA controls receiving DMARDs, adjusting for age, sex and baseline co-morbidity. Results. At baseline, the mean (s.d.) DAS-28 was 6.4 (5.6). Of the patients, 70.3% were EULAR responders at 12 months. At 6 months, older patients [adjusted odds ratio (OR) 0.97 per year; 95% CI 0.95, 0.99], females (adjusted OR 0.51; 95% CI 0.34, 0.78) and patients on corticosteroids (adjusted OR 0.45; 95% CI 0.28, 0.72) were less likely to achieve a EULAR response. Over 1776.2 person-years of follow-up (median 3.07 per person), the IRR of SAEs compared with controls was not increased (0.9; 95% CI 0.8, 1.3). Conclusions. Anti-TNF therapies have a good response rate in PsA, and have an adverse event profile similar to that seen in a control cohort of patients with seronegative arthritis receiving DMARD therapy

    Influence of inflammatory polyarthritis on quantitative heel ultrasound measurements.

    BACKGROUND: There are few data concerning the impact of inflammatory polyarthritis (IP) on quantitative heel ultrasound (QUS) measurements. The aims of this analysis were i) to determine the influence of IP on QUS measurements at the heel and, ii) among those with IP to determine the influence of disease related factors on these measurements. METHODS: Men and women aged 16 years and over with recent onset IP were recruited to the Norfolk Arthritis Register (NOAR). Individuals with an onset of joint symptoms between 1989 and 1999 were included in this analysis. At the baseline visit subjects underwent a standardised interview and clinical examination with blood taken for rheumatoid factor. A population-based prospective study of chronic disease (EPIC-Norfolk) independently recruited men and women aged 40 to 79 years from the same geographic area between 1993 and 1997. At a follow up assessment between 1998 and 2000 subjects in EPIC-Norfolk were invited to have quantitative ultrasound measurements of the heel (CUBA-Clinical) performed. We compared speed of sound (SOS) and broadband ultrasound attenuation (BUA), in those subjects recruited to NOAR who had ultrasound measurements performed (as part of EPIC-Norfolk) subsequent to the onset of joint symptoms with a group of age and sex matched non-IP controls who had participated in EPIC-Norfolk. Fixed effect linear regression was used to explore the influence of IP on the heel ultrasound parameters (SOS and BUA) so the association could be quantified as the mean difference in BUA and SOS between cases and controls. In those with IP, linear regression was used to examine the association between these parameters and disease related factors. RESULTS: 139 men and women with IP and 278 controls (mean age 63.2 years) were studied. Among those with IP, mean BUA was 76.3 dB/MHz and SOS 1621.8 m/s. SOS was lower among those with IP than the controls (difference = -10.0; 95% confidence interval (CI) -17.4, -2.6) though BUA was similar (difference = -1.2; 95% CI -4.5, +2.1). The difference in SOS persisted after adjusting for body mass index and steroid use. Among those with IP, disease activity as determined by the number of swollen joints at baseline, was associated with a lower SOS. In addition SOS was lower in the subgroup that satisfied the 1987 ACR criteria. By contrast, disease duration, steroid use and HAQ score were not associated with either BUA or SOS. CONCLUSIONS: In this general population derived cohort of individuals with inflammatory polyarthritis there is evidence from ultrasound of a potentially adverse effect on the skeleton.     Anticarbamylated protein antibodies are associated with long-term disability and increased disease activity in patients with early inflammatory arthritis:Results from the Norfolk Arthritis Register

    Objectives: Anticarbamylated protein (anti-CarP) antibodies are a novel family of autoantibodies recently identified in patients with inflammatory arthritis. The aim of this study was to investigate their association with long-term outcomes of disability and disease activity over 20 years’ follow-up in a cohort of patients with inflammatory polyarthritis (IP).  Methods: Norfolk Arthritis Register recruited adults with recent-onset swelling of ≥2 joints for ≥4 weeks from 1990 to 2009. At baseline, Health Assessment Questionnaire (HAQ) and 28 joint disease activity scores (DAS28) were obtained, and C reactive protein, rheumatoid factor (RF), anticitrullinated protein antibodies (ACPA) and anti-CarP antibodies were measured. Further HAQ scores and DAS28 were obtained at regular intervals over 20 years. Generalised estimating equations were used to test the association between anti-CarP antibody status and longitudinal HAQ and DAS28 scores; adjusting for age, gender, smoking status, year of inclusion and ACPA status. Analyses were repeated in subgroups stratified by ACPA status. The relative association of RF, ACPA and anti-CarP antibodies with HAQ and DAS28 scores was investigated using a random effects model.  Results: 1995 patients were included; 1310 (66%) were female. Anti-CarP antibodies were significantly associated with more disability and higher disease activity, HAQ multivariate β-coefficient (95% CI) 0.12 (0.02 to 0.21), and these associations remained significant in the ACPA-negative subgroups. The associations of RF, ACPA and anti-CarP antibodies were found to be additive in the random effects model.  Conclusions: Anti-CarP antibodies are associated with increased disability and higher disease activity in patients with IP. Our results suggest that measurement of anti-CarP antibodies may be useful in identifying ACPA-negative patients with worse long-term outcomes. Further, anti-CarP antibody status provided additional information about RF and ACPA

    Influence of arthritis and non-arthritis related factors on areal bone mineral density (BMDa) in women with longstanding inflammatory polyarthritis: a primary care based inception cohort

    <p>Abstract</p> <p>Background</p> <p>The aim of this analysis was to determine the relative influence of disease and non-disease factors on areal bone mineral density (BMD<sub>a</sub>) in a primary care based cohort of women with inflammatory polyarthritis.</p> <p>Methods</p> <p>Women aged 16 years and over with recent onset inflammatory polyarthritis were recruited to the Norfolk Arthritis Register (NOAR) between 1990 and 1993. Subjects were examined at both baseline and follow up for the presence of tender, swollen and deformed joints. At the 10<sup>th </sup>anniversary visit, a sub-sample of women were invited to complete a bone health questionnaire and attend for BMD<sub>a </sub>(Hologic, QDR 4000). Linear regression was used to examine the association between BMD<sub>a </sub>with both (i) arthritis-related factors assessed at baseline and the 10<sup>th </sup>anniversary visit and (ii) standard risk factors for osteoporosis. Adjustments were made for age.</p> <p>Results</p> <p>108 women, mean age 58.0 years were studied. Older age, decreasing weight and BMI at follow up were all associated with lower BMD<sub>a </sub>at both the spine and femoral neck. None of the lifestyle factors were linked. Indices of joint damage including 10<sup>th </sup>anniversary deformed joint count and erosive joint count were the arthritis-related variables linked with a reduction in BMD<sub>a </sub>at the femoral neck. By contrast, disease activity as determined by the number of tender and or swollen joints assessed both at baseline and follow up was not linked with BMD<sub>a </sub>at either site.</p> <p>Conclusion</p> <p>Cumulative disease damage was the strongest predictor of reduced femoral bone density. Other disease and lifestyle factors have only a modest influence.</p

    Measuring disease prevalence: a comparison of musculoskeletal disease using four general practice consultation databases

    BackgroundPrimary care consultation data are an important sourceof information on morbidity prevalence. It is not knownhow reliable such figures are.AimTo compare annual consultation prevalence estimatesfor musculoskeletal conditions derived from fourgeneral practice consultation databases.Design of studyRetrospective study of general practice consultationrecords.SettingThree national general practice consultation databases:i) Fourth Morbidity Statistics from General Practice(MSGP4, 1991/92), ii) Royal College of GeneralPractitioners Weekly Returns Service (RCGP WRS,2001), and iii) General Practice Research Database(GPRD, 1991 and 2001); and one regional database(Consultations in Primary Care Archive, 2001).MethodAge-sex standardised persons consulting annualprevalence rates for musculoskeletal conditions overall,rheumatoid arthritis, osteoarthritis and arthralgia werederived for patients aged 15 years and over.ResultsGPRD prevalence of any musculoskeletal condition,rheumatoid arthritis and osteoarthritis was lower thanthat of the other databases. This is likely to be due toGPs not needing to record every consultation made fora chronic condition. MSGP4 gave the highestprevalence for osteoarthritis but low prevalence ofarthralgia which reflects encouragement for GPs to usediagnostic rather than symptom codes.ConclusionConsiderable variation exists in consultationprevalence estimates for musculoskeletal conditions.Researchers and health service planners should beaware that estimates of disease occurrence based onconsultation will be influenced by choice of database.This is likely to be true for other chronic diseases andwhere alternative symptom labels exist for a disease.RCGP WRS may give the most reliable prevalencefigures for musculoskeletal and other chronic diseases
